Scattering laser light on cold atoms: Toward multiple scattering signals from single-atom responses

We deduce the coherent backscattering signal from two distant laser-driven atoms using single-atom equations. The background and interference components of the double scattering spectrum obtained by this alternative approach agree exactly with the results of the standard master equation treatment. In contrast to the master equation, however, the new approach is suitable for the generalization to a large number of atomic scatterers.
